Doing Your Own Service Work

If you want to do some of your own service work, you'll
want to use the proper service manual. It tells you much
more about how to service your vehicle than this manual
can. To order the proper service manual, see "Service
and Owner Publications" in the Index.
You should keep a record with all parts receipts and list
the mileage and the date of any service work you
perform. See "Maintenance Record" in the Index.
CAUTION:
You can be injured and your vehicle could be
damaged if you try to do service work on a
vehicle without knowing enough about it.
D
Be sure you have sufficient knowledge,
experience, the proper replacement parts
and tools before you attempt any vehicle
maintenance task.
